Why Amazon Suspends Seller Accounts

Compliance is the primary driving force behind Amazon’s operations. The platform acts proactively whenever it detects any sign of trouble – the account gets suspended right away.
For this reason, many sellers find themselves shocked upon receiving a message about their Amazon account being suspended, thinking that they did nothing wrong. Intentions don't come into play here – what's looked at is the pattern.
Among the most typical causes of Amazon account suspension are:
performance issues
policy violations
authenticity issues
linked accounts
1. Performance Issues:
Performance statistics make up a frequent source of trouble. Once your order defect rate exceeds 1% and/or late shipment rate surpasses 4%, you get closer to getting your account suspended by Amazon. While these rates might not seem significant, for the platform, they certainly do.
2. Policy Violations:
Violations of various Amazon policies are another common cause of suspension notices. From outdated listings to restricted products and misuse of keywords – all of these could cost you your Amazon seller account. Even though you did not mean to break the rules, Amazon will hold you accountable for the violations.
3. Authenticity Issues:
Many times, there's also the case of inauthentic products. When a client raises suspicions about the authenticity of your item, you must be ready to provide proof in the form of invoices and supplier statements. Without those, reinstating your Amazon account will be nearly impossible.
4. Linked Accounts:
Of late, linked accounts have emerged as a prominent trigger for Amazon account suspension. Amazon may suspend linked accounts simultaneously if it detects that they are related by means of common IP addresses, devices, and/or financial information.

How to Fix Amazon Account Suspension with a Strong POA
If there’s anything that will make Amazon restore your account, it is the right Amazon plan of action suspension.
Amazon wants facts, not explanations based on your emotions. You need to give a response that shows Amazon that you are aware of the problem and have found the solution.
There are three important parts that are always part of the best plan of action.
First is the root cause of your problems; secondly, the steps that you have taken to solve the problem; and lastly, the measures you will take in order to ensure that the problem does not repeat.
When you have a problem with the authenticity of your products, you must include all details of the problem in your root cause analysis. The corrective actions must list all the steps that you have already taken to solve the problem. Preventive action, on the other hand, must include all steps that you will take in order to ensure that there is no recurrence in the future.
Amazon Seller Suspension Appeal Template (Practical Structure)
Instead of writing a long, emotional explanation, keep your appeal structured and professional.
A good Amazon seller suspension appeal template typically includes:
A brief acknowledgment of the issue
A clear explanation of the root cause
Specific corrective actions already taken
Preventive measures for the future
A concise closing requesting reinstatement
The goal is clarity, not length. Amazon reviewers go through thousands of appeals, so your response needs to be easy to understand and directly relevant.
Linked Accounts: A Hidden Reason Behind Many Suspensions
Linked accounts are some of the fastest-rising causes of Amazon account suspension.
Amazon utilizes many metrics to track links among accounts, like IP addresses, device usage, billing information, and log-in behaviors. Something as seemingly innocent as logging into another account from the same network may cause a connection.
It is important to note that not all linked account suspensions are a result of fraudulent activities. Some cases are simply a misunderstanding.
When your Amazon account gets suspended for linked accounts, you have to do some investigating. Consider previous accounts, devices shared, any consultants, and other team members who may have had access to your account.
To resolve this, your Amazon appeal suspension should clearly explain the following:
How the connection occurred
Why your account operates independently
Supporting documentation proving separation
If there’s an older suspended account involved, resolving that may be necessary before achieving Amazon account reinstatement.
How Long Does Amazon Suspension Last?
Another common question that pops up for sellers is, “How long does an Amazon suspension last?”
The response differs.
For some accounts, it lasts from 24 to 72 hours upon the filing of an effective first appeal. In other cases, it can stretch out over several weeks, depending on whether or not there is more than one appeal necessary.
However, what matters most is your Amazon suspension plan of action.
A clear, well-structured appeal almost always gets faster results than rushed submissions.
How to Avoid Amazon Seller Account Suspension

For those seeking to know how to avoid Amazon seller account suspension, consistency and systems hold the key.
Fixing the problems as they arise is not sufficient. Instead, what matters is preventing issues from arising. Here’s what every Amazon seller should focus on:
1. Track Account Health:
One must monitor their account status on a regular basis. Simply go to Seller Central → Performance → Account Health.
Indicators such as order defect rate, late shipment rate, and cancellation rate must not be overlooked.
2. Verified Suppliers Only:
It is an essential part of running a business on Amazon to have a transparent and clean supply chain. Work with trusted suppliers and ensure documentation is always available for your records.
3. Stay Policy Compliant:
Amazon’s policies change more often than sellers expect. It’s important to stay on top of them. What was acceptable a year ago may no longer be acceptable.
4. Avoid Risky Tactics:
And lastly, the most crucial step to take is to avoid shortcuts. For instance, creating fake reviews and manipulating listings is tempting. However, it is among the fastest routes to an account suspension on Amazon.
